A 58-year-old man with type 2 diabetes takes acarbose with meals and glimepiride once daily. One evening he becomes diaphoretic, tremulous and confused. His wife gives him a glass of orange juice, but after 15 minutes he shows no improvement. The most likely explanation for this poor response is:

  • A Acarbose inhibits alpha-glucosidase, so the sucrose in juice cannot be split into absorbable glucose
  • B Orange juice contains fructose, which acarbose converts to a non-absorbable complex
  • C Glimepiride has blocked intestinal glucose transporters
  • D Hypoglycaemia under these circumstances can only be corrected intravenously
Correct answer: A. Acarbose inhibits alpha-glucosidase, so the sucrose in juice cannot be split into absorbable glucose

Explanation

Acarbose reversibly inhibits intestinal alpha-glucosidase enzymes, preventing hydrolysis of dietary disaccharides such as sucrose into monosaccharides. During hypoglycaemia in a patient taking acarbose, correction requires pure glucose (dextrose) or lactose-free monosaccharide sources, since table sugar and fruit juices will not raise blood glucose effectively. Intravenous dextrose is reserved when the patient cannot swallow safely.
